Understanding Cannabis and Its Compounds
To understand how cannabis can support fitness and recovery, it’s important to truly understand what it’s about:
- Cannabinoids: Active compounds in cannabis that interact with the body’s endocannabinoid system (ECS). The most notable cannabinoids are THC (responsible for the “high”) and CBD (non-psychoactive, known for therapeutic benefits).
- Terpenes: Aromatic compounds in cannabis that influence its effects. Terpenes like myrcene, limonene, and pinene contribute to the plant’s scent and therapeutic properties.
Cannabis and Fitness: How do they Connect?
1. Enhanced Exercise Performance Cannabis is increasingly being recognized for its potential to enhance exercise performance. Here’s how:
- Motivation and Focus: Some cannabis strains high in THC may enhance motivation and focus during workouts, making exercise more enjoyable.
- Pain Relief: Cannabis has well-documented pain-relieving properties. By reducing discomfort, it can help individuals push through challenging workouts.
- Stress Reduction: Pre-workout anxiety or stress can be alleviated with cannabis strains high in CBD or calming terpenes, promoting a more positive mindset.
2. Muscle Recovery Recovery is essential for muscle repair and overall performance, and cannabis can play a key role:
- Anti-Inflammatory Effects: CBD is known for its ability to reduce inflammation, speeding up recovery and decreasing muscle soreness after intense exercise.
- Pain Management: Both THC and CBD can help alleviate post-workout muscle soreness, providing relief and aiding recovery.
- Improved Sleep Quality: Quality sleep is crucial for muscle recovery. Strains high in CBD or sedative terpenes like myrcene can improve sleep by reducing anxiety and promoting relaxation.
